Julian name meaning:

The name Julian originated from the Latin name Iulianus, which was derived from the Roman family name Julius. It is a masculine name that has a rich history and carries multiple meanings. The most common interpretation of the name Julian is "youthful" or "downy-bearded," referencing the soft facial hair that appears during adolescence. This meaning reflects the name's association with youthfulness, vitality, and energy.

Julian is also associated with the Julian calendar, a calendar system introduced by Julius Caesar in 45 BC. This association adds a sense of significance and historical importance to the name. Additionally, Julian has ties to Christianity, as it is derived from the Latin word for "belonging to Julius," and was used as a name for early saints.
